The night was quieter than it should have been, as if the entire city had decided to hold its breath. Irina stood in front of the mirror in her room, silently staring at her reflection. The dark circles under her eyes bore witness to countless sleepless nights, and her thoughts tangled like spiderwebs, impossible to escape.

The letter she had read hours ago in the old storage room still dominated her mind. The words, written in Dimitri's handwriting, stirred a mix of emotions within her—fear, confusion, and nostalgia.

Irina (thinking): "Was everything planned from the beginning? What does this mean?"






As she gazed at her face, her mind drifted back to the memory of her first encounter with Dimitri. It was in a small bookstore on the outskirts of the city. Back then, he was nothing more than an eccentric stranger—possessing an irresistible allure and a way of speaking that was full of riddles.

Irina (whispering): "How did I end up here? How did my life turn into this chaos?"






She decided to return to the storage room the next day. Her curiosity was stronger than her fear. The place seemed darker and colder than it had been the previous night. Every step inside the building felt heavy, as if the ground itself resisted her presence.

On the wooden table where she had left the box, she found something new—a small letter written on an old piece of paper.

Irina (reading): "Irina, if you're reading this, it means you've started searching for the truth. But truth is never easy. It is painful, and it often comes at a price."

She set the paper aside, a shiver running down her spine.

Irina (thinking): "Who is leaving these messages? And can I really trust anything here?"






As she tried to steady herself, she heard footsteps behind her. She turned quickly, her hands moving instinctively to find something to defend herself with.

A man stood in the shadows, wearing a long black coat, his face obscured by darkness.

Irina (cautiously): "Who are you? And why are you following me?"

Mysterious Man: "I am someone who knows more than I should. And Dimitri is one of the reasons that led me here."






He stepped closer, his movements deliberate but careful, as if he was afraid of frightening her more than she already was.

Mysterious Man (calmly): "Irina, Dimitri was not who you thought he was. Your story with him is not just a simple love story—it's something far greater."

Irina (anxiously): "What do you know about me? And what is your connection to Dimitri?"

The man pulled a small photograph from his pocket and handed it to her. It was of Dimitri, standing next to a stranger.

Mysterious Man: "This is Dimitri. And this is me. We were colleagues in the past. But things changed."






He began telling a strange story about a secret organization that exploited people like Dimitri. He hinted that Dimitri was not just an ordinary man, but someone who carried something within him that made him a target for the organization.

Mysterious Man: "He tried to escape them, but he couldn't. And now, you are part of this mess."






The night was eerily dark, the cold wrapping around the city like a heavy cloak of shadows. Irina walked hesitantly behind the mysterious man who had suddenly appeared in her life, anxiety consuming her. The streets were empty, save for the relentless sound of rain hitting the ground.

Irina (thinking): "How did I get here? Who is this man? And why do I feel like everything is falling apart around me?"

The man, who still hadn't revealed his name, walked with confident steps but had remained silent since they left the storage room. Every time Irina tried to speak, he raised his hand, signaling her to stay quiet.

Irina (frustrated): "How long are you going to keep this mystery? I followed you, but I need answers!"

He suddenly stopped, turning to her with piercing eyes, as if he could read her thoughts.

Mysterious Man: "Irina, you have no idea what's happening around you. The less you know, the safer you are."






They continued walking until they reached an old building—abandoned, yet carrying an aura of secrecy. He struggled to open the rusted door before motioning for her to enter.

Irina (cautiously): "What is this place? It looks like a shelter for the forgotten."

Mysterious Man (dryly): "A safe place. Or at least, safer than where we came from."

She stepped inside. The lighting was dim, the furniture scattered as if abandoned in haste. On one of the walls, she noticed an old painting with the same symbol she had seen in Dimitri's letter.

Irina (alarmed): "This… this is the same symbol! Tell me now, what does it mean? And who are you?"

The man sat on an old wooden chair and gestured for her to sit as well.

Mysterious Man: "My name is Sergei. I was one of Dimitri's closest… or rather, one of those who shared his fate."






Sergei sat in silence for a moment, as if gathering his thoughts, before he finally spoke in a calm yet heavy voice.

Sergei: "Dimitri was not an ordinary person, as you know. But what you don't know is that he was part of a secret organization operating in the shadows. This organization isn't what you think—it's not just a group with mysterious goals. They control lives, reshape destinies."

Irina (tense): "But what does this have to do with me? Why was I targeted?"

Sergei: "Because you were the missing link—the connection between the past and the future. Dimitri knew that. He knew you weren't just another woman in his life. You were the key they had been searching for all these years."






As Sergei spoke, Irina listened in silence, as if drowning in a sea of unbelievable truths. He told her about his first meeting with Dimitri and how the man was never who he seemed to be.

Sergei: "Dimitri didn't want to tell you the truth because he knew you would leave him. But he couldn't stay away from you. He knew that every step he took toward you put you in danger, yet he couldn't resist."

Irina recalled the moments she had spent with Dimitri—his cryptic gazes, his words that always seemed to hold a deeper meaning.

Irina (whispering): "He was hiding something all along… I could feel it."

Sergei: "And let's be honest, Irina. Dimitri was willing to sacrifice everything, even his life, to keep you away from this dark world. But it seems things have spiraled out of his control."






As their conversation continued, a sudden explosion echoed nearby. The room shook, debris falling from the ceiling.

Sergei (sharply): "They found us. We need to move now!"

Irina was still trying to process what was happening when Sergei grabbed her hand, pulling her toward a back exit.

Irina (shouting): "Who found us? Who are they?!"

Sergei: "The ones who hunted Dimitri. And now, they are after you. If you want to stay alive, don't stop running!"






They ran through the dark alleys, their pursuers closing in. Irina's breath was ragged, fear consuming her. But one thing was clear—her life would never be the same again, and everything she once believed to be true was a lie.






In a crucial moment, Sergei suddenly stopped at a narrow corner, pulling out a gun from his pocket.

Sergei (firmly): "Irina, listen to me carefully. No matter what happens, don't look back. Just keep running. Do you understand?"

Irina (teary-eyed): "But… what about you?"

Sergei: "I'll buy you some time. Just go now!"

She hesitated for a long moment before nodding, then ran into the darkness.

As her footsteps faded, the sound of gunfire echoed behind her. Her breath quickened, and tears streamed down her face.

"Where can I go? And who am I, really?"
